Your future role
Take on a new challenge and apply your planning and organizing expertise in a new cutting-edge field. You’ll report to Bogdan, in Bucharest and work alongside his professional and dedicated teammates.
You'll manage and coordinate our fleet management activities. Day-to-day, you’ll work closely with teams across the business (project management, engineering, industrial, quality, different support functions), offer support to our local teams, maintain the link with our central teams and much more.
You’ll specifically take care of the preventive maintenance planning of the trains, monitoring and reporting the daily situation of the trains, the availability indicators and the kilometers traveled by the fleet.
We’ll look to you for:
- Planning the introduction of the trains for preventive and corrective maintenance, according to the regulations in force in collaboration with the Traction Operator of the client
- Keeping in touch with the depots and update the situation of the train’s park under maintenance to ensure trains in exchange to accomplish the traffic graph.
- Following and notifying the special situations that have appeared in the circulation of the trains by introducing this information in SAP, opening in SAP the working orders for depots and in case of problems arising to contact the depot manager / fleet manager.
- Reporting and keeping daily analysis of the train park on all lines and the achievement of the availability indicator according to the maintenance contract in collaboration with client’s Traction Operator.
- Collaborating with client in making decisions regarding traffic problems.
- Keeping daily record of the number of kilometers traveled by the trains in circulation with passengers and kilometers traveled by the test trains on all the routes.
- Supporting other departments Operation, Engineering, Sourcing, Logistics in order to achieve the organization objective.
- Taking the responsibilities of Depot Manager in his absence from the depot.
